In-depth face to face meeting with the appointed experts covering both technical and business aspects followed by a report including the recommended next steps. (Typically, 2 weeks to complete this step).
The PhotonHub Evaluation Team reviews and scores your proposal in accordance with the evaluation criteria (see below) . You will be invited to participate online to address any questions and will receive a formal evaluation report within one week. Possible outcomes are: granted; approved pending resubmission with modi cations; or cancelled. (Evaluation meetings every 1 – 2 months).
We will contact you to discuss your photonics innovation ambition and determine the right technology approach & partners for you. This discussion will take place under NDA.
PhotonHub appoints a project leader to work with you in preparing and submitting your customised innovation project proposal covering tasks, milestones, deliverables, budget, and IP ownership. (Typically, 1-2 months to complete this step)
Once granted, an innovation project agreement is signed by your company and all of the partners involved. The project kicks off and you are on your way!

The total project budgets outlined below are for illustrative purposes only and reflect the subsidy level for companies other than LSCs. The project budget is determined during the proposal development phase. The subsidy goes to the PhotonHub partner(s) to cover their costs in providing innovation support to the company, up to a maximum value of €250k.
Available for cross-border innovation projects to:
Subsidy Levels:
First €40k of innovation project budget fully subsidised; 85% of total budget subsidised thereafter*
(*Except for LSCs where it is 50% of total budget subsidised.)
Illustrative examples: | Total innovation project budget | Subsidised for company | Cash contribution of company |
---|---|---|---|
€50k | €48.5k | €1.5k | |
€100k | €91k | €9k | |
€220k | €193k | €27k |
